This is not a must-have, and it is not for all archs so far anyway:

Dump an I-pipe panic trace on ordinary kernel oopses. For me this turned
out to be useful already, but not everyone may love to see his/her
console flooded with call-history traces on oops, though this only
happens if the tracer is enabled.

Comments welcome.

Following your suggestion, this version makes the panic freezing a
configurable option. Also, it adds support for x86_64 (note that all
arch bits are in the same patch here!) and should now cover any arch
I-pipe runs on.

I would say: No longer an RFC, now a request to apply.
